Meaning & origin

Kanya is a Sanskrit name meaning 'maiden' or 'young woman', and in Hindu tradition it is an epithet of the goddess Parvati. The name first appeared in U.S. birth records in 1972, but it was not until the 2000s that it saw a modest increase in usage, peaking in 2007. Since 2006, however, its trajectory has been falling, suggesting a brief spike in interest that has since subsided. While Kanya has never broken into the top 1000 and does not have a single 1-in-N estimate for recent years due to low frequency, its cultural resonance and simple, melodic sound keep it in circulation among families seeking a name with Indian roots. The name has a strong spiritual undertone, and though it remains uncommon, it carries a sense of quiet strength and tradition.

Derived from Sanskrit कन्या (kanyā) meaning 'maiden, daughter, young woman'. In Hindu mythology, Kanya is an epithet of the goddess Parvati, and the name also refers to the zodiac sign Virgo. The name has long been used in India and has gained some popularity in the West through cultural exchange.

Questions parents ask

What does the name Kanya mean?
Kanya means 'maiden' or 'young woman' in Sanskrit. It is also a name for the goddess Parvati and the astrological sign Virgo.
How popular is the name Kanya?
Kanya has never ranked in the U.S. top 1000. It reached its highest usage in 2007, with a few hundred births that year. Since 2006, its usage has been declining.
Is Kanya a boy or girl name?
Kanya is almost exclusively used as a girl's name.
